Research On Cognitive Impairment Of "Redox Reaction" In Senior One Students

The redox reaction is the focus and difficulty of the first-stage chemistry teaching.Based on teaching experience and interviews with front-line teachers,it is found that there are certain difficulties and obstacles for high school students to learn,and the learning of redox reactions will directly affect the subsequent elements and their study of compounds,electrochemistry and organic chemistry.For this reason,it is necessary to investigate the cognitive impairment of the first year students in the study of redox reactions and to clarify the following issues:What are the main areas of high school freshman cognitive impairment? What are the levels of different types of cognitive impairment? What are the causes of different types of cognitive impairment?The research is mainly based on Gagne's theory of classification of learning results,and explores cognitive barriers in the study of redox reactions in senior high school students from three aspects: verbal information,intellectual skills and cognitive strategies.Based on the literature and interviews,the survey questionnaire was prepared,and after the initial test and amendment,the test was officially conducted.A survey was conducted on 394 students in two county-level middle schools in Hebei Province.Based on the result of the survey,interviews with teachers and students were conducted to investigate the causes of cognitive impairment.The conclusions of the study are as follows:(1)On the whole,senior high school students have a moderate degree of cognitive impairment in learning redox reactions.In terms of the obstacle dimension,there is a milder degree of cognitive impairment in the dimension of verbal information disorder,a moderate degree of cognitive impairment in the dimension of intellectual skills,and a more severe degree of cognitive disorder in the dimension of cognitive strategy.(2)Among the five secondary dimensions,there is a milder degree of cognitive impairment with respect to the keyword and name of redox reaction.The macroscopic,microscopic,and symbolic triple representation of the transformational obstacle dimension has moderate cognitive impairment.There is a moderate degree of cognitive impairment in the dimension of obstacles in the analysis,concept group,and equation;there is a moderatedegree of cognitive impairment in the dimension of the "redox reaction" law;the degree of obstacle in the migration and application of the "redox reaction" is severe.(3)There are no significant differences in the dimensions of verbal information barriers between students of different types of schools,and significant differences in the two dimensions of barriers in intellectual skills and cognitive strategies.(4)Factors affecting cognitive impairment of speech information include: thinking set,teachers' teaching methods,the content of the "redox reaction" itself and the lack of ability to represent knowledge and problems;factors affecting cognitive impairment of intellectual skills include: thinking set,teacher teaching methods,the content of the "redox reaction" itself,the low level of knowledge structure and the limitations of high school students 'cognitive levels;factors affecting cognitive strategies and cognitive impairment include: teachers' teaching methods,the lack of ability to process basic factual materials using thinking,and limitations of high school students' cognitive levels.Finally,based on the statistical analysis of the questionnaire and interview results,four teaching suggestions are put forward:(1)Create real situations and strive to overcome obstacles for students to understand;(2)Construct a knowledge network and strive to overcome obstacles for students to discriminate;(3)Analyze the microscopic essence,and strive to overcome the obstacles of students' triple representation transformation;(4)Guide self-directed learning and strive to overcome obstacles to students 'migration and application.
